As per Hindu religion, Navratri falls 4 times in a year which is celebrated in different states of India. The spirit of feminism is worshipped during Shukla Paksha (waxing of moon) of Ashadha month is Ashadha Gupt Navratri.
During Ashadha (june) Gupt Navratri extensive prayer is offered to please Goddess Durga for blessings.
Ashadha (June) Gupt Navratri Ideology
Ashadha (june) Gupt is also referred to as ‘Gayatri’ or ‘Shakambari Navratri’ and it falls between June and July.

It is called ‘Gupt’ (secret) because devotees worship this in secret and even this is not very popular with most people. Gayatri Navratri is celebrated with vivacity and reverence in all parts of India, especially in northern regions like Uttarakhand, Punjab, Himachal Pradesh, Haryana.

Ashadha Gupt Navratri Importance
- Shakambari Navratri is observed with the main motive to propitiate the Goddess of Bhagwati in different forms so devotees can be blessed with knowledge, wealth, prosperity and other positive energies.
- Goddess Durga is worshiped for 9 days with the recitation of Durga Saptashati who eases the distress and pleased her to show kindness.
- Strict fasting for 9 days will be followed by tantrik, sadhak or any other devotees. They can only take sattvic food like fruits or dairy products.

- On this auspicious occasion, Hindu followers chant mantras to Goddess Shakti to invoke heavenly grace. Religious scriptures like ‘Devi Mahatmya’, Shrimad Bhagwad Gita’ and ‘Durga Saptashati’ are very auspicious.
- However, South Indians observe Maa Varahi who is the consort of Lord Vishnu during this time.
- Worshiper also chants ‘ Durga Battissi’ or another name of Adhya Shakti during this Navratri. It is said that this 9 day practice can bring spiritual happiness and bring the material. With the utmost secret worship, Goddess ends all the obstacles and helps followers to achieve peace and harmony in life.
Ashadha Gupt Navratri Puja Vidhi
Ashadha Gupt Puja is performed just like other Navratri. Goddess Shakti or Durga is worshiped every morning and evening starting from Pratipda following Shubh Muhurat.

On Ashtami or Navami, the fast is observed with Kanya (girl) Puja.
The practitioners like tantrik and sadhak practice ten Mahavidyas instead of forms of Goddesses. All seekers should do Tantra Sadhna under the guidance of Guru or trained tantrik. If sadhana is not done in the proper way, it can have adverse effects on the seeker.
During puja, the first three days follower worship Maa Bhagwati and her manifestations, next 3 days to Devi Laxmi and last 3 days to Maa Saraswati. Pure souls will certainly receive benefits and blessings.
